Transaction 70a83d2f790f9299d467e024944c9c8cc3330e22e9b868c586e0a4dab228f86c

1 Input
2 Outputs
  • 70a83d2f790f9299d467e024944c9c8cc3330e22e9b868c586e0a4dab228f86c:0
  • value  538717818
    address  1G2m33R8BRNhS7ZApMMBMP5gqG2XYeVNk5
  • 70a83d2f790f9299d467e024944c9c8cc3330e22e9b868c586e0a4dab228f86c:1
  • value  3048751
    address  156BJqdp4DhQUEsPh6ubHuCjCtP3cS2Rr9